Great responses! I used to get so angry when I would see the whole case of beer was gone and he would go out every night. I guess I let that anger go when I realized his actions weren't a reflection of myself and I began to take control of what I could and let go of what i couldnt control, which was his actions. Being angry was only punishing myself for his actions, I realized there was no point. I do still feel a twinge of anger when he is being himself, but I get over it quickly when I realize I am in control and can get Off this ride any time.

Also pp mentioned yoga, I second this. It has really taught me to step out of a situation and analyze what is the best way to handle things.
